Questions to Ask During a Pet Dog Day Care Excursion
If you're thinking about taking your canine to a day care, be sure to visit and ask some inquiries. You'll intend to learn daily schedules, clinical emergency situation treatments and cleaning and sanitizing practices.
Also, make sure to ask just how they group canines right into play teams and if they remember of your pet's personality. This will assist stop your dog from being put with a harsh friend or obtaining tripped up by a timid puppy.

7. Exactly how will they deal with your pet's personality?
Every center is different, but you need to still discover as much concerning the business model and exactly how they operate. This consists of security methods, vaccination criteria, and habits management.
Normally, canines are divided by dimension and play style. A good center will likewise use favorable support methods and avoid utilizing squirt bottles, shaker containers, pet correctors, or shock collars. This is since these tools can be extremely dangerous to pet dogs.

10. What do you need to bring?
You may require to bring your pet's medical records, vaccination charts and contracts. Additionally, you might want to pack some acquainted products like a KONG or favorite treats.
Ask if they have sufficient room for each and every animal, and just how often canines are secured. Ideally, the staff ought to have a ratio of no greater than 15 pet dogs per one manager. Inquire about their puppy program, as well!
